Photo gallery: Candlelight vigil for brothers at Tampines accident site

SOME 300 people turned up for a candlelight vigil on Sunday night at the spot in Tampines where two brothers were killed in a horrific accident last week.

Nigel Yap, 13, and his brother Donavan, seven, were on their way home on a bicycle when they were hit by a cement mixer truck last Monday evening.

Led by MP for Tampines, Mr Baey Yam Keng, the crowd held candles and walked from a nearby block to the junction of Tampines Avenue 9 and Tampines Street 45 at about 8pm.
